Aylin Gökmen is a Swiss-Turkish filmmaker who earned a B.A. in Arts from the University of Lausanne and an M.A. in documentary filmmaking from the DocNomads Erasmus Mundus program. Combining a documentary and experimental approach, her works revolve around themes of memory, imagination and landscape. In 2020, she co-founded A Vol d’Oiseau, a production structure dedicated to the development of various Swiss and international projects.
